FAQs

Here are some frequently asked questions related to Surgical Technicians job postings and salaries in New York:

Q What are the requirements for becoming a Surgical Technician in New York?
A To become a Surgical Technician in New York, one typically needs to complete an accredited surgical technology program and obtain certification. Some employers may also require prior experience in the field.

Q Are there opportunities for career advancement for Surgical Technicians in New York?
A Yes, there are opportunities for career advancement for Surgical Technicians in New York. These may include specialization in certain surgical areas, advancing to surgical assistant positions, or taking on administrative roles with additional education and certifications.
